Wingman Special Ending Available Exclusively on DMM TV

DMM TV, the comprehensive streaming service by DMM, has released an exclusive special ending for the live-action drama Wingman. This limited-edition version is only available to DMM TV subscribers and serves as a tribute to the original anime’s iconic ending.

The Story Behind Wingman

Originally serialized in Weekly Shonen Jump (1983–1985), Wingman is the debut work and one of the most iconic creations of renowned manga artist Masakazu Katsura, known for Video Girl Ai and I"s. The live-action adaptation follows the story of Kenta (played by Maito Fujioka), a high school sophomore and tokusatsu hero enthusiast.

With the help of his friends, Kenta creates his own hero persona, "Wingman," complete with handmade suits and weapons. His life takes an unexpected turn when Aoi (Konatsu Kato), a mysterious girl from the otherworldly realm of Podrimus, appears on Earth. Using the power of the "Dream Note," Kenta gains the ability to transform into Wingman for five minutes, setting the stage for a thrilling adventure.

Faithful Adaptation with Stunning Visuals

Directed by Koichi Sakamoto, known for his work in tokusatsu and action films, the series brings Katsura’s imaginative world to life. Katsura himself serves as the "General Supervisor" to ensure the adaptation stays true to the source material.

The cast includes rising stars such as Maito Fujioka and Konatsu Kato, alongside established talents like Mamoru Miyano and Akio Otsuka, delivering a blend of action, drama, and nostalgia for fans of the original series.


Tribute to the Anime Ending with "WING LOVE"

The final episode, DMM TV Special Ending, offers a unique version of the ending. It combines key scenes from the live-action drama with cuts from Katsura’s original manga, paying homage to the classic anime’s ending sequence. Accompanied by the iconic theme song "WING LOVE," this special ending elevates the emotional impact of the finale, making it a must-watch for fans.
